Frequently asked questions about data processing pipelines

+Is data processing pipelines in demand in 2026?

Yes. data processing pipelines appears in 208 job postings indexed by Skillenai over the 90 days ending 2026-08-29, with demand down 22% vs the prior 4 weeks. It is most often required for Software Engineer roles (36% of Software Engineer postings list it).

+What jobs require data processing pipelines?

According to the Skillenai jobs index over the 90 days ending 2026-08-29, the job titles most likely to require data processing pipelines are Software Engineer (36% of postings list data processing pipelines), Data Engineer (8% of postings list data processing pipelines), Machine Learning Engineer (8% of postings list data processing pipelines).

+What skills are commonly paired with data processing pipelines?

Across job postings indexed by Skillenai (90 days ending 2026-08-29), data processing pipelines most often appears alongside Python, machine learning, SQL, AWS, C++.

+Where is data processing pipelines most in demand?

As of 2026-08-29, the metro areas posting the most jobs requiring data processing pipelines are Mountain View, New York City, San Francisco, Seattle, Toronto, according to the Skillenai jobs index.
